But the k is retained at this time for a reason that will appear in the sequel. In fact, in the construction of the models, the circumstance that k is within our choice enables us, after assigning numerical values to the other constants, to assign such a value to k as will bring all the twenty-seven lines within easy reach. In a word, we use k, so to speak, as a lever.
